In Loving Memory of Curtis Alexander
(Fondly known as “Raj”)
Sunrise: 27th November 1958
Sunset: 17th June 2026
It is with deep sadness that we announce the passing of Curtis Alexander, affectionately known as “Raj.”
Curtis was a well-known and cherished individual who touched the lives of many. He was a true “fix thing” type of man, someone who was always willing to lend a helping hand and find a way to get things done. His helpful nature, humour, and warm personality made him someone people could always count on and remember fondly.
Born on 27th November 1958, Curtis spent his early years growing up in Tunapuna before moving to Diego Martin at the age of 13. He attended primary school in Curepe and later continued his education at Belmont Secondary School.
Curtis had a love for the simple pleasures in life. He enjoyed watching movies, especially old-style comedy and intense action films. He also loved fishing, swimming, cooking, and enjoying good food. His favourite colour was grey, a small reflection of his personal style and taste.
Raj will always be remembered for his laughter, kindness, willingness to help others, and the many memories he created with those who knew and loved him.
Though he has departed this life, his spirit and the impact he made will continue to live on in the hearts of his family, friends, and all who had the privilege of knowing him.
May he rest in eternal peace.
